Honey is naturally resistant to spoilage and can last for years without refrigeration. In this blog post, we’ll dive into the world of honey storage, separating fact from fiction, and providing you with the knowledge you need to keep your honey at its best. Is crystallized honey safe to consume? You can eat the honey in a crystallized form: Honey can last for a long time without being refrigerated, but doing so may change the way it feels and looks. Yes, you can store honey in the refrigerator, but it is not necessary. The best ways to store honey are in a sealed glass jar or plastic container. You can also use a honey pot or a bucket with a lid as long as it’s airtight.
